Cultural Complexes of Latin America: South and the Soul explores the theory and embodied reality that cultural complexes are powerful determinants in the attitudes, behaviour, and emotional life of individuals and groups. The contributing authors, all from several Latin American countries, present compelling historical, anthropological, sociological, mythological, psychological, and personal perspectives on a part of the world that is full of promise and despair. Latin America is a region marked with psychic "fault lines" that cause disturbances in its populations on issues of social class, ethnicity, race, religion, gender, and even geography. Many of these "fault lines" appear to have their origins in the "basic fault" that occured with the conquest and colonization of the region, primarily by the Spanish and Portuguese. This "basic fault" and its subsequent "fault lines" reside not only in various groups that compete for status, power, wealth, and meaning but in the psyche of every Latin American individual who carries the emotional memories and scars of conflicts that have coursed through their mixed blood for generations.

Ofrece una historia de la psicología en nuestro subcontinente que comprende también su situación actual y sus perspectivas futuras. Describe el importante papel de esta ciencia considerando sus diversas áreas de estudio. Aborda la vida y obra de sus precursores y la labor de sus mejores exponentes de hoy en día. Asimismo ofrece un análisis de las dificultades y soluciones propuestas sin olvidar factores ideológicos y políticos.

The Fifteenth Triannual Congress of the International Association for Analytical Psychology (IAAP) took place on the grounds of St. John's College in Cambridge, England from 19 to 24 August 2001. It was a memorable occasion both in its preparation and its incarnation and the present volume is meant to preserve at least a portion of what transpired: the papers comprising the program. The presentations and events were more far-reaching and all-inclusive than ever before, incorporating numerous political and intercultural issues and including representatives from psychoanalysis and other fields of endeavour for the first time.

How do cultural complexes affect the collective psyche? Based on Jung's theory of complexes, this book offers a new perspective on the psychological nature of conflicts between groups and cultures by introducing the concept of the cultural complex. This modern version of Jung's idea offers an original view of the forces that prevent human attempts to bring a peaceful, collaborative spirit to conflict between groups. Leading analysts and academics from a range of cultural backgrounds present their own perspective on the concept, demonstrating how the effects of cultural complexes can be felt in the behaviour of disenfranchised, oppressed and traumatised groups across the world. Ultimately, a clearer understanding of the source and nature of group conflict is reached through discussion of central subjects including: * Collective trauma and cultural complexes * Exploring racism: a clinical example of a cultural complex * Cultural complexes in the history of Jung, Freud and their followers. The Cultural Complex represents a valuable contribution to analytical psychology and will undoubtedly also stimulate dialogue in the fields of sociology, political science and cultural studies.

En este libro, Jorge Gissi analiza cómo se expresa la identidad latinoamericana a través de la obra de cinco premios Nobel de literatura: Gabriela Mistral, Miguel Ángel Asturias, Pablo Neruda, Gabriel García Márquez y Octavio Paz, autores que han plasmado ideas consistentes con muchos de los aspectos de la identidad latinoamericana. El análisis se realiza desde la psicoantropología de la identidad, disciplina que revela semejanzas y diferencias entre los escritores, y muestra también que ellas expresan una reivindicación de identidad, autoestima e integración cultural en nuestro continente.

El nombre y la figura de Cristo marcan a Iberoamérica. Los primeros españoles y portugueses que llegaron al Nuevo Mundo trajeron esta presencia de lo cristiano, en el siglo dieciséis. El Cristo de la península ibérica llegó tanto mediante la presencia y forma de vida de los conquistadores, como por la prédica de los misioneros que los acompañaron. Este libro fue escrito con la convicción de que hay una realidad histórica y social bien establecida que se puede describir como protestantismo latinoamericano, y que es posible trazar el mapa de un desarrollo teológico en el seno de ese protestantismo. La centralidad del tema cristológico se explica tanto por la herencia teológica recibida del protestantismo misionero como por la respuesta contextual a la realidad cultural y espiritual de América Latina, un continente nominalmente cristiano. Si el Cristo católico llegó a nosotros vía España, el Cristo del protestantismo ha venido de otros países europeos –como Inglaterra, Francia y Holanda– y de los Estados Unidos de Norteamérica. El Cristo protestante representa la herencia de los reformadores religiosos del siglo XVI, aunque Él no se originó con ellos ni por medio de ellos. Samuel Escobar intenta adentrarse en la comprensión de algunas obras claves de estos diferentes autores como Míguez Bonino, Justo González, Juan A. Mackay y Emilio Núñez, entre otros, que pueden servir como hitos para detectar el itinerario del pensamiento evangélico latinoamericano.
